5/8/2017

Mysql Update Table With Subquery

I need to check (from the same table) if there is an association between two events based on date-time. One set of data will contain the ending date-time of certain.

In this tutorial, you will learn how to use MySQL UPDATE statement to update data in a table. Use CREATE TABLE. LIKE to create an empty table based on the definition of another table, including any column attributes and indexes defined in.

Mysql Update Table With Subquery

My. SQL Subquery. Summary: in this tutorial, we will show you how to use the My. SQL subquery to write complex queries and explain the correlated subquery concept. A My. SQL subquery is a query nested within another query such as SELECT, INSERT, UPDATE or DELETE. In addition, a My. SQL subquery can be nested inside another subquery. A My. SQL subquery is called an inner query while the query that contains the subquery is called an outer query.

A subquery can be used anywhere that expression is used and must be closed in parentheses. The following query returns employees who work in the offices located in the USA. Then, this result set is used as an input of the outer query. My. SQL subquery in WHERE clause. We will use the payments table in the sample database for the demonstration. My. SQL subquery with comparison operators. You can use comparison operators e.

WHERE clause. For example, the following query returns the customer who has the maximum payment. First, use a subquery to calculate the average payment using the AVG aggregate function. Then, in the outer query, query the payments that are greater than the average payment returned by the subquery. This table is referred to as a derived table or materialized subquery. The following subquery finds the maximum, minimum and average number of items in sale orders.

UPDATE is a DML statement that modifies rows in a table. Single-table syntax: UPDATE In this tutorial, we will show you how to use MySQL subquery to write more complex queries. In addition, we will show you how to use correlated subquery.

I'm creating an SQL statement that will return a month by month summary on sales. The summary will list some simple columns for the date, total number of sales and.

MAX(items), MIN(items), FLOOR(AVG(items)). Number, COUNT(order. Epson Aculaser C9100 Driver Windows Xp. Number) AS items. GROUP BY order. Number) AS lineitems;    MAX(items),MIN(items),FLOOR(AVG(items))        order. Number,COUNT(order.

Number)ASitems    GROUPBYorder. Number)ASlineitems; Try It Out. My. SQL correlated subquery. In the previous examples, you notice that a subquery is independent. It means that you can execute the subquery as a standalone query, for example.

Number. COUNT(order. Number) AS items. Adobe Photoshop Cs6 Full Pre Cracked Glass. GROUP BY order. Number;    COUNT(order. Number)ASitems. Unlike a standalone subquery, a correlated subquery is a subquery that uses the data from the outer query. In other words, a correlated subquery depends on the outer query.

A correlated subquery is evaluated once for each row in the outer query. In the following query, we select products whose buy prices are greater than the average buy price of all products in each product line. Hence, the average buy price will also change. The outer query filters only products whose buy price is greater than the average buy price per product line from the subquery.

My. SQL subquery with EXISTS and NOT EXISTSWhen a subquery is used with the EXISTS or NOT EXISTS operator, a subquery returns a Boolean value of TRUE or FALSE.